Medium droplet sizes are the most widely used and are typically good for systemic herbicides, insecticides and fungicides. Calibration is the process of adjusting or modifying spray equipment so it is capable Follow these steps to select a nozzle for a particular application: Refer to the pesticide label for the recommended spray volume in gallons per acre (GPA) for your situation. nozzle pesticide atomizing misting Use drift reducing nozzles or larger capacity nozzles that produce larger spray droplets, Pay attention to weather conditions and adjust application methods accordingly, Brass is the least durable nozzle material, Plastic lasts two to six times longer than brass, Stainless steel lasts four to six times longer than brass, Ceramic lasts 20 to 50 times longer than brass. Coarse droplet sizes are used with systemic, residual and soil-applied herbicides or to minimize spray drift. The key to reducing drift is to reduce the number of fine particles, or small-sized droplets, within the spray volume, while still maintaining your spray patterns for even coverage. Flat FanUsed for broadcast and band spraying, ConeUsed for spot, directed and air assisted spraying, StreamingUsed for application of liquid fertilizer. Materials such as ceramic may be more expensive initially, but cost less in the long run because they wear longer.
